Also, if you have your own custom HUD config for each table type, make sure that you have set the default HUD, on the 'Use For:' tab, to a site that you do not play on.


The important steps are to set your preferred seating in the poker client, then set it in HM to match, and then open a single (6max or FR, but don't try setting them up at the same time) table and play. Do NOT move any of the panels until after it has imported the first hand and you can see your own stats. When you use Preferred Seating the poker client 'spins' the table around so you are sitting in the right seat. This causes the panels to be out of position during your first hand in the Big Blind. It's a good idea to add the players abb. name stat to the HUD while first setting it up.

FYI - The abb. name stat can be color coded to correspond to the players number of Big Blinds. Very useful for spotting short-stackers. ;)

Now you should be able to reposition them with Ctrl+Right-Click+Drag. Once in position go to Table Manager > File > Save Positions. Now if you open a new table of the same type and play, the stats should be correct, after it has imported your first played hand. Then do the same thing for Full Ring that you did for 6max.

How do i configure Holdem Manager to work with Full Tilt Poker? (http://www.holdemmanager.net/faq/?f=142)

You can scroll towards the end where it talks about Auto Center and Preferred seating. Set the auto center in FTP. Set the preferred seating in HM. Sit at a table, but do not move any stats yet. The table 'spins' around to put you in the center seat, but the HUD stats do not spin around until after it has imported the first hand you actually play (Big Blind typically). Once HM has imported a hand, and you can see your own stats displayed, you can drag the panels to their proper locations. Save the positions and they should be the same next time you sit in.
